Output 80664a1d56135c2a69144d3b23a4a1b43e2eda507ede13d5ba516e4641aef792:2

value
7793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23adbeff4743bdfe7f123b65782e8e20bd21bc27 OP_EQUAL
address
34wfiM6XA1FzAdGwjaRScMXF3styekykq1
transaction
80664a1d56135c2a69144d3b23a4a1b43e2eda507ede13d5ba516e4641aef792
spent
true